diff options
author | Marek Olšák <[email protected]> | 2012-08-30 05:38:02 +0200 |
---|---|---|
committer | Marek Olšák <[email protected]> | 2012-08-31 01:19:03 +0200 |
commit | 64db3cc6ad2d52dec46119e5b80030393cb60bf4 (patch) | |
tree | fab4b4b57c3ff9da009a766d78ec3e7ecb769ed1 /src/gallium/drivers/r600/evergreen_hw_context.c | |
parent | f8a8f069ee2dae35470c6e2a681e5e110044e6fe (diff) |
r600g: implement MSAA for Cayman
Everything works except for blitting MSAA colorbuffers, which isn't
so trivial on Cayman. It's a rarely-used feature anyway.
Diffstat (limited to 'src/gallium/drivers/r600/evergreen_hw_context.c')
-rw-r--r-- | src/gallium/drivers/r600/evergreen_hw_context.c | 1 |
1 files changed, 1 insertions, 0 deletions
diff --git a/src/gallium/drivers/r600/evergreen_hw_context.c b/src/gallium/drivers/r600/evergreen_hw_context.c index d2f09498566..b2ea7e238dd 100644 --- a/src/gallium/drivers/r600/evergreen_hw_context.c +++ b/src/gallium/drivers/r600/evergreen_hw_context.c @@ -500,6 +500,7 @@ static const struct r600_reg cayman_context_reg_list[] = { {R_028798_CB_BLEND6_CONTROL, 0, 0}, {R_02879C_CB_BLEND7_CONTROL, 0, 0}, {R_028800_DB_DEPTH_CONTROL, 0, 0}, + {CM_R_028804_DB_EQAA}, {R_028808_CB_COLOR_CONTROL, 0, 0}, {R_02880C_DB_SHADER_CONTROL, 0, 0}, {R_028810_PA_CL_CLIP_CNTL, 0, 0}, |